在 JavaScript 中,我們可以使用fs
模塊的writeFile
方法來保存 JSON 文件。
const fs = require('fs'); const data = { name: 'John', age: 30 }; const dataJSON = JSON.stringify(data); fs.writeFile('data.json', dataJSON, (err) =>{ if (err) throw err; console.log('Data saved to file!'); });
在上面的例子中,我們首先定義了一個對象data
,然后使用JSON.stringify()
方法將其轉換為 JSON 字符串dataJSON
。
接著,我們使用fs.writeFile()
方法將dataJSON
寫入名為data.json
的文件中。該方法接受三個參數:文件名(包含路徑),要寫入的數據和回調函數。回調函數在寫入操作完成后被調用,并傳遞一個可能發生的錯誤。
當執行上述代碼時,控制臺將輸出Data saved to file!
,表示 JSON 數據已成功保存到文件中。